There's a certain satisfaction that comes with growing vegetables and it's something that is not very easy to do when you're surrounded by huge Sugar Maple trees. Also, the spaces I do have to grow vegetables I would prefer to use to grow flowers. ![]() However, this year, I decided to try growing Sugar Snap Peas on one area of the fence and I picked my first harvest this week. They tasted so good right off the vine it was hard to save enough to bring inside! ![]() I love the fresh flavor of raw peas so I just decided to use them in my salad last night. A little balsamic vinaigrette (Newman's Own Organic) topped off the fresh flavors. Nothing like eating the fruits of your labor to make you smile! ![]() ![]() Here is a collage of some of my clematis that are also making me smile this week. ![]() From top left, going clockwise, you see Maria Cornelia, Hagley Hybrid, Romantica, Blue Light with Piilu in the center.
